Tracking consumables for maintenance and triggering orders

Purpose

1.1. Automate tracking of maintenance consumables (e.g., lubricants, filters, parts) to prevent shortages or overstocking.
1.2. Centralize real-time inventory management and usage frequency for all production-critical consumables.
1.3. Automate reorder processes when stock hits predefined safety thresholds.
1.4. Ensure compliance, uptime, and safety by automating notifications, approvals, and supplier communication.
1.5. Enable seamless, automated integration with ERP, warehouse, and procurement systems for accurate asset management.

Trigger Conditions

2.1. Inventory of a consumable falls below the minimum reorder level.
2.2. Scheduled maintenance event triggers projected depletion of specific consumables.
2.3. Maintenance staff logs a withdrawal of a tracked item.
2.4. Supplier lead time exceeds required replenishment window.
2.5. Manual override or emergency stock-out scenario detected automatedly.

Platform Variants

3.1. Microsoft Power Automate
• Feature/Setting: Automated Flows; configure trigger on SharePoint inventory list change; action: send Teams notification and invoke purchase order API.
3.2. SAP ERP
• Feature/Setting: MM (Material Management) Automatic Reorder Point Planning; configure BAPI_REQUISITION_CREATE API for automated PR creation.
3.3. Oracle Fusion Cloud
• Feature/Setting: Inventory Min-Max Planning; configure REST API integration for auto-replenishment order trigger.
